嵌入式java学习路线
时间: 2024-09-28 16:01:58 浏览: 47
java学习历程
5星 · 资源好评率100%
嵌入式Java学习通常分为以下几个阶段:
1. **基础知识准备**:
- 先掌握基础的计算机科学知识,如数据结构、算法、操作系统原理等。
- 学习Java语言的基础语法,包括类、对象、继承、封装和多态。
2. **平台无关性的Java SE**:
- 学习Java Standard Edition (SE),理解JVM(Java虚拟机),熟悉IDE(如Eclipse, IntelliJ IDEA)的使用。
- 熟悉Java集合框架、异常处理、文件I/O、网络编程等内容。
3. **针对特定平台的学习**:
- 对于嵌入式Java,重点在于Java Micro Edition (ME) 或者Android Embedded Development:
- ME适合嵌入式设备,比如手机、游戏机的轻量级应用。
- Android Embedded Development则涉及Linux内核下的Java开发,用于Android Things项目。
4. **硬件接口与驱动程序**:
- 学习如何与硬件交互,如GPIO操作、串口通信、SPI/I2C等,可能需要了解相关的C语言API或JNI(Java Native Interface)。
5. **实战项目**:
- 经历一些实际项目的开发,例如物联网应用、小型设备管理软件等,这有助于巩固理论并提升解决问题的能力。
6. **持续学习**:
- 随着技术发展,关注嵌入式Java的新技术和框架,如Raspberry Pi开发、Minecraft Education Edition Java版等。
阅读全文